The Indianapolis Metropolitan Development Commission unanimously approved Ordinance Amendment 2026A-001, effectively enacting a temporary ban on new data center developments in Marion County until 2027. The vote, which saw all six ballots cast in favor, was met with cheering and applause.

This decision means that no new data center projects can be approved within the City of Indianapolis and Marion County for the next three years. The measure aims to pause new developments in the region.
